ALL EXTERIOR SIGNAGE SHALL REQUIRE A PERMIT. <br />MOTION CARRIED 5-0. • <br />4.3 Request by Elk River Lutheran Church for Conditional Use Permit for Church (Institutional <br />Use) at 729 Main Street (Former First National Bank Public Hearing -Case No. CU 12-03 <br />Jeremy Barnhart reviewed the staff report. He discussed details regarding landscaping, <br />internal layout, exterior changes and parking. Mr. Barnhart noted that a variance regarding <br />the amount of impervious surface will be reviewed by the Board of Adjustments on March <br />20, 2012. Staff recommends approval of the proposal with the five conditions listed in the <br />staff report to the Planning Commission dated March 13, 2012. Mr. Barnhart reviewed each <br />of the five conditions. <br />Vice Chair Westberg opened the public hearing. No comments were received and the <br />public hearing was closed. <br />Vice Chair Westberg asked if the parking agreements with adjacent property owners have <br />been obtained in writing. Mr. Barnhart stated he has received one from Dares. A <br />representative from Elk River Lutheran stated that they also have one from First National <br />Bank. <br />Commissioner Bell asked if the handicap parking spaces would be on city property. Mr. <br />Barnhart stated staff is recommending the handicap parking be located on private property, <br />on the lower level behind the building. Commissioner Bell stated he had some concern <br />about parking if there were a number of events going on downtown at the same time.
